Genoa vs. Napoli (5pm)

Genoa’s best run this season finally came to an end when they met Lazio last week. Their five-match unbeaten run helped them stay clear of the drop zone, and they are now six points above. 

Napoli’s inconsistent domestic form has left them nine points behind Inter at the top, and they even struggled against relegation-threatened Fiorentina last week. Genoa have been one of the hardest teams to beat for the Partenopei in recent years, as Napoli won only two of the last five H2Hs. 

Eight of their last 10 meetings featured goals from both sides. Given Napoli’s recent defensive struggles, BTTS is the best option on Saturday.

Genoa vs. Napoli top betting tip: Both teams to score


Fiorentina vs. Torino (7:45pm)

La Viola are a step away from safety – a point below Lecce, and with the seemingly easiest task this weekend out of all relegation-threatened sides. 

The positive is that Fiorentina have been scoring more goals than usual. The negative – their defence remains leaky. But Torino lost four of their last five Serie A games, and don’t look like a team that has a clear direction. 

This is a gamble, as all five most recent H2Hs finished with under 2.5 goals, but we anticipate an exciting exchange between two defenseless teams. Only two teams have conceded more away goals than Torino in Serie A this season. And we’ve seen glimpses of La Viola’s true potential lately.

Fiorentina vs. Torino top betting tip: Over 2.5 goals, Over 1.5 Fiorentina goals
